--- src/trunk/translate/misc/lru.py 2009-11-17 15:12:48 UTC (rev 13169)
+++ src/trunk/translate/misc/lru.py 2009-11-17 15:14:47 UTC (rev 13170)
@@ -48,20 +48,38 @@
# appended again
self.queue.pop()
+ if len(self) >= self.maxsize:
+ # maximum cache size exceeded, cull old items
+ #
+ # note queue is the real cache but its size is boundless
+ # since it might have duplicate references.
+ #
+ # don't bother culling if queue is smaller than weakref,
+ # this means there are too many references outside the
+ # cache, culling won't free much memory (if any).
+ while len(self) >= self.maxsize <= len(self.queue):
+ cullsize = max(int(len(self.queue) / self.cullsize), 2)
+ try:
+ for i in range(cullsize):
+ self.queue.popleft()
+ except IndexError:
+ # queue is empty, bail out.
+ break
+ finally:
+ # call garbage collecter manually since objects
+ # with circular references take some time to get
+ # collected
+ for i in range(5):
+ if gc.collect() == 0:
+ break
self.queue.append((key, value))
WeakValueDictionary.__setitem__(self, key, value)
- if len(self) > self.maxsize:
- while len(self.queue) and len(self) > (self.maxsize - self.maxsize / self.cullsize):
- # maximum cache size exceeded, remove an old item
- self.queue.popleft()
- while gc.collect() > 0:
- pass
-
+
def __getitem__(self, key):
value = WeakValueDictionary.__getitem__(self, key)
# check boundaries to minimiza duplicate references
- while len(self.queue) > 1 and self.queue[0][0] == key:
+ while len(self.queue) > 0 and self.queue[0][0] == key:
# item at left end of queue pop it since it'll be appended
# to right
self.queue.popleft()
